Tips For Making A Lighter Version At Home

To create a lighter version of Chicken Salad Chick Potato Soup at home, consider using low-sodium chicken broth as the base instead of traditional broths to reduce the overall sodium content. Opt for lean turkey bacon or turkey sausage as a flavorful alternative to regular bacon or sausage, which can help lower the fat content of the dish. Incorporating plenty of fresh vegetables like celery, carrots, and kale can add fiber and nutrients without significantly increasing the calorie count.

You can also experiment with different herbs and spices to enhance the flavor profile of the soup without adding extra calories. Swap out heavy cream for a lighter alternative like reduced-fat milk or plain Greek yogurt to maintain creaminess while cutting down on saturated fats. Lastly, be mindful of portion sizes and consider serving the soup with a side of mixed greens or a piece of whole-grain bread to round out the meal while keeping the overall calorie intake in check.

Can The Potato Soup Be Customized To Fit Specific Dietary Needs, Such As Reducing Sodium Or Fat Content?

Yes, potato soup can be easily customized to fit specific dietary needs. To reduce sodium content, opt for low-sodium broth and refrain from adding additional salt during cooking. To lower fat content, consider using low-fat milk or a dairy-free alternative like almond milk instead of heavy cream. Additionally, incorporating more vegetables and herbs for flavor can enhance the taste without relying on excessive salt or added fats. By making these simple adjustments, you can enjoy a delicious and nutritious potato soup that meets your dietary requirements.
